Selected Features
OLED displays
LG OLED48CXPUB and LG OLED65W8PUA have organic light-emitting diode (OLED) displays. This is a self-emissive display which can completely turn off individual pixels leading to the ideal black levels and better contrast during HDR compared to any LCD displays. This makes them to be the best choice for dark rooms. OLED enables a simpler internal structure than conventional displays. With just a few layers, OLED TVs are very lightweight and thin. OLED displays also have better viewing angles. However, they are not able to achieve such high brightness as modern LCD displays which makes them less suitable in bright rooms.
HDR10
LG OLED48CXPUB and LG OLED65W8PUA support HDR10 which was announced on August 27, 2015, by the Consumer Technology Association and uses the wide-gamut Rec. 2020 color space. It is not backward compatible with SDR. It sends static metadata via video stream to the TV which calibrates its screen brightness and color according to that. HDR10 is technically limited to a maximum of 10,000 nits of brightness and uses 10-bit color which corresponds to 1024 shades of the primary RGB colors.
Dolby Vision
LG OLED48CXPUB and LG OLED65W8PUA also support Dolby Vision which is an update to HDR10 by adding dynamic metadata that can be used to more accurately adjust brightness levels up to 10,000 nits on a scene-by-scene or frame-by-frame basis and supports up to 12-bit color depth (4096 shades of RGB) and 8K resolution.
